Output b279987d88fc0f617f7bb355656ee8c5383f3771dee929e7cf371a0b3bbb6025:0

value
132112646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90a7756e0d791a2c960e756328c11dda2cbdda9b OP_EQUAL
address
3EssqQJLF5M4Z3B9i5JEmeB1osAXGr1WJN
transaction
b279987d88fc0f617f7bb355656ee8c5383f3771dee929e7cf371a0b3bbb6025
spent
true